[PATCH] powerpc/pkeys: copy pkey-tracking-information at fork()

From: Ram Pai <hidden>
Date: 2018-12-03 20:45:38

At fork(), the pkey tracking information is not copied over
to the mm_struct of the child. This can cause the child to erroneously
allocate keys that were already allocated. Any allocated execute-only
key is lost aswell.

Add code; called by dup_mmap(), to copy the pkey state from
parent to child explicitly.

This problem was originally found by Dave Hansen on x86, which turns
out to be a problem on powerpc aswell.

 arch/powerpc/include/asm/mmu_context.h |   15 +++++++++------
 arch/powerpc/mm/pkeys.c                |    7 +++++++
 2 files changed, 16 insertions(+), 6 deletions(-)
diff --git a/arch/powerpc/include/asm/mmu_context.h b/arch/powerpc/include/asm/mmu_context.h
index 0381394..cb16146 100644
--- a/arch/powerpc/include/asm/mmu_context.h
+++ b/arch/powerpc/include/asm/mmu_context.h
@@ -217,12 +217,6 @@ static inline void enter_lazy_tlb(struct mm_struct *mm,
 #endif
 }
 
-static inline int arch_dup_mmap(struct mm_struct *oldmm,
-				struct mm_struct *mm)
-{
-	return 0;
-}
-
 #ifndef CONFIG_PPC_BOOK3S_64
 static inline void arch_exit_mmap(struct mm_struct *mm)
 {
@@ -247,6 +241,7 @@ static inline void arch_bprm_mm_init(struct mm_struct *mm,
 #ifdef CONFIG_PPC_MEM_KEYS
 bool arch_vma_access_permitted(struct vm_area_struct *vma, bool write,
 			       bool execute, bool foreign);
+void arch_dup_pkeys(struct mm_struct *oldmm, struct mm_struct *mm);
 #else /* CONFIG_PPC_MEM_KEYS */
 static inline bool arch_vma_access_permitted(struct vm_area_struct *vma,
 		bool write, bool execute, bool foreign)
@@ -259,6 +254,7 @@ static inline bool arch_vma_access_permitted(struct vm_area_struct *vma,
 #define thread_pkey_regs_save(thread)
 #define thread_pkey_regs_restore(new_thread, old_thread)
 #define thread_pkey_regs_init(thread)
+#define arch_dup_pkeys(oldmm, mm)
 
 static inline u64 pte_to_hpte_pkey_bits(u64 pteflags)
 {
@@ -267,5 +263,12 @@ static inline u64 pte_to_hpte_pkey_bits(u64 pteflags)
 
 #endif /* CONFIG_PPC_MEM_KEYS */
 
+static inline int arch_dup_mmap(struct mm_struct *oldmm,
+				struct mm_struct *mm)
+{
+	arch_dup_pkeys(oldmm, mm);
+	return 0;
+}
+
 #endif /* __KERNEL__ */
 #endif /* __ASM_POWERPC_MMU_CONTEXT_H */
diff --git a/arch/powerpc/mm/pkeys.c b/arch/powerpc/mm/pkeys.c
index b271b28..5d65c47 100644
--- a/arch/powerpc/mm/pkeys.c
+++ b/arch/powerpc/mm/pkeys.c
@@ -414,3 +414,10 @@ bool arch_vma_access_permitted(struct vm_area_struct *vma, bool write,
 
 	return pkey_access_permitted(vma_pkey(vma), write, execute);
 }
+
+void arch_dup_pkeys(struct mm_struct *oldmm, struct mm_struct *mm)
+{
+	/* Duplicate the oldmm pkey state in mm: */
+	mm_pkey_allocation_map(mm) = mm_pkey_allocation_map(oldmm);
+	mm->context.execute_only_pkey = oldmm->context.execute_only_pkey;
+}

This function is small and perhaps could have been a static inline in
<asm/mmu_context.h>, but arch_dup_mmap() doesn't seem to be in a hot
path so the segregation of implementation details to pkeys.c is nice
from an organization point of view.

Shouldn't this check if pkeys are actually in use?

eg:
diff --git a/arch/powerpc/mm/pkeys.c b/arch/powerpc/mm/pkeys.c
index cf87dddefbdc..587807763737 100644
--- a/arch/powerpc/mm/pkeys.c
+++ b/arch/powerpc/mm/pkeys.c
@@ -418,6 +418,9 @@ bool arch_vma_access_permitted(struct vm_area_struct *vma, bool write,
 
 void arch_dup_pkeys(struct mm_struct *oldmm, struct mm_struct *mm)
 {
+	if (static_branch_likely(&pkey_disabled))
+		return;
+
 	/* Duplicate the oldmm pkey state in mm: */
 	mm_pkey_allocation_map(mm) = mm_pkey_allocation_map(oldmm);
 	mm->context.execute_only_pkey = oldmm->context.execute_only_pkey;

Ideally we'd actually do it in the inline so that the function call to
arch_dup_pkeys() can be avoided. But it looks like header dependencies
might make that hard.

Shouldn't this check if pkeys are actually in use?
Yes. That will make it better. However not checking it, will not hurt. Just that
it will do some unnecessary copying.
